Description
Originally published for the opening of the Toshiba Gallery of Japanese Art at the Victoria and Albert Museum, this book celebrates and sets in context many of its greatest treasures. The museum's Japanese holdings, acquired over a period of 150 years, started with the international exhibitions of the second half of the 19th century and the great private collections formed in Britain at the beginning of the 20th. The result is a panorama of Japan's achievements in art and design from the earliest times, with particular emphasis on ceramics, lacquer, textiles, prints and metalwork from the 17th century to modern day.
